Mary Albergotti Williams, 93, died Thursday, December 16, 2010, at Rainey Hospice House in Anderson.

Mrs. Williams was a lifetime resident of Columbia and the widow of John Herbert Williams. She was the daughter of the late William Greer and Beulah Argoe Albergotti of Columbia. She was the granddaughter of Andrew Durant Argoe, Lodoskie Sturkie Argoe, William Greer Albergotti and Mary Hutson Salley Albergotti, all of Orangeburg County. Mrs. Williams had retired from Dun & Bradstreet, Inc. She was a member of Shandon United Methodist Church.

Surviving are her brother William G. Albergotti Jr. of Anderson; nieces and nephews, Samuel F. Albergotti of Anderson; Raymond M. Albergotti of New York, N.Y.; Mary A. Bowman of Staunton, Va., and Paul M. Albergotti of Anderson; great-nieces and nephews, William Greer Albergotti III of Charleston, Martha F. Albergotti of Columbia, Claudia B. Albergotti and Gaston Albergotti, both of Anderson; Katherine Hamer Preston of Harrisonburg, Va., Charles Hamer of Waynesboro, Va.; a great-great-niece, Kailee Eldred of Harrisonburg, Va.; a great-great-nephew, Hunter Hamer of Waynesboro, Va.

A memorial service for Mrs. Williams will be held at 1 p.m. Sunday, December 19, 2010, at the chapel of the Shandon United Methodist Church. Dunbar Funeral Home, Devine Street Chapel, is in charge of services.
